Aging of wood - Analysis of color changing during natural aging and heat treatment

Résumé

The color properties of aging wood samples from historical buildings have been compared with those of recent wood samples that were treated at temperatures ranging 90 to 180 °C. The result of kinetic analysis obtained by the time-temperature superposition method showed that the color change during natual aging was mainly due to a slow and mild oxidation process. In other words, heat treatment could accelerate the changes in wood color that occur during aging. The results has been interpreted that the aging and the subsequent change in wood color begin at the same time of tree harvesting.
